Output 117c7629e0eb3df94bfef1e91fbaa1d0aa89f34223f387187d6e099df32b7da8:0

value
12095028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e81994faea10c32095425e7886e744269d781cf OP_EQUAL
address
3EgX8UHGZJZ7TSQY8fmNSHDMZTXCZ53QpN
transaction
117c7629e0eb3df94bfef1e91fbaa1d0aa89f34223f387187d6e099df32b7da8
spent
true